Ammonium Hydroxide: Properties, Applications, Safety, and Industrial Supply Access

Introduction

                   Ammonium Hydroxide (NH₄OH), also known as aqueous ammonia or ammonia solution, is a colorless liquid formed when ammonia gas dissolves in water. It’s widely used in industrial manufacturing, laboratories, agriculture, cleaning formulations, and wastewater treatment.


Informational: Chemical Structure and Key Properties

Ammonium hydroxide is not a single compound but rather a solution of ammonia (NH₃) in water, where a small fraction reacts to form hydroxide ions (OH⁻) and ammonium ions (NH₄⁺).

Chemical Overview

Parameter Details
Chemical Name Ammonium Hydroxide
Common Names Aqueous Ammonia, Ammonia Solution
Chemical Formula NH₄OH (often written as NH₃·H₂O)
CAS Number 1336-21-6
Molecular Weight 35.05 g/mol
Appearance Colorless liquid with strong pungent odor
Density ~0.91 g/cm³ (at 25°C for 10% solution)
Boiling Point Variable, depends on concentration
Solubility Completely soluble in water; reacts with acids and metals
pH (10% solution) 11.0 – 12.0 (strongly basic)

In water, the equilibrium reaction is:

NH₃ + H₂O ⇌ NH₄⁺ + OH⁻

This balance makes ammonium hydroxide an alkaline solution capable of neutralizing acids and dissolving organic materials.


Navigational: Common Applications and Industrial Uses

Ammonium hydroxide’s usefulness spans many industries due to its alkaline reactivity, volatility, and buffering ability.

1. Industrial Manufacturing

  • Acts as a pH regulator in textile dyeing, rubber vulcanization, and detergent formulation.
  • Used in the production of fertilizers, plastics, and synthetic fibers.
  • Essential for etching and cleaning silicon wafers in the semiconductor industry.

2. Laboratory and Analytical Uses

  • Functions as a reagent for preparing metal hydroxides (e.g., copper(II) hydroxide).
  • Used as a complexing agent in qualitative inorganic analysis.
  • Serves as a buffer solution in biochemical and chemical research.

3. Food and Beverage Industry (Under Regulation)

  • Food-grade ammonium hydroxide is sometimes approved as a pH adjuster or leavening agent, regulated by FDA (21 CFR 173.315).
  • Used under strict concentration limits to ensure consumer safety.

4. Agriculture and Environmental Control

  • Employed in nitrogen supplementation for soils and livestock feed.
  • Used in wastewater treatment to control pH and neutralize acidic contaminants.

5. Cleaning and Sanitizing

  • Common ingredient in household and industrial cleaners, especially for glass, stainless steel, and surfaces contaminated by grease or organic residues.

Health, Safety, and Environmental Considerations

While useful, ammonium hydroxide must be handled carefully due to its corrosive and irritant properties.

Health Hazards

  • Inhalation: Can irritate or burn respiratory tissues.
  • Skin Contact: Causes irritation or chemical burns on prolonged exposure.
  • Eye Contact: May lead to serious eye damage.
  • Ingestion: Harmful and potentially corrosive to mucous membranes.

Safety Measures

  • Always handle in a well-ventilated area or fume hood.
  • Wear chemical-resistant gloves, goggles, and protective clothing.
  • In case of spills, neutralize with dilute acid (e.g., acetic acid) and flush with water.

Storage Guidelines

  • Store in cool, dry, and ventilated environments.
  • Keep away from acids, halogens, and oxidizing agents.
  • Use containers made of corrosion-resistant materials (HDPE or stainless steel).

Transactional: Legal Handling and Supply Access

Ammonium hydroxide is not a controlled substance, but its transport, storage, and disposal are regulated due to its hazard classification.

Regulatory Overview

Regulatory Body Classification / Guidelines
OSHA (U.S.) Classified as a corrosive liquid; requires GHS labeling
EPA (U.S.) Subject to Toxic Release Inventory reporting
REACH (EU) Regulated under EC No. 1907/2006 for safe chemical use
DOT (Transport) Classified as hazardous material (UN 2672)
Globally Harmonized System (GHS) Corrosive and irritant hazard codes H314, H335

Environmental Management

Ammonium hydroxide is biodegradable but must be neutralized before disposal. Waste solutions can contribute to ammonia pollution in waterways, leading to:

  • Oxygen depletion in aquatic systems.
  • Toxicity to fish and invertebrates.

Proper disposal includes neutralization and dilution under the supervision of environmental safety officers.


Comparison Table: Ammonium Hydroxide vs. Related Alkalis

Property Ammonium Hydroxide (NH₄OH) Sodium Hydroxide (NaOH) Potassium Hydroxide (KOH)
Form Aqueous solution Solid / pellets Solid / flakes
Alkalinity Moderate Very strong Strong
Volatility High (ammonia vapor) Non-volatile Non-volatile
Toxicity Irritant, corrosive Corrosive Corrosive
Common Uses Cleaning, pH control, fertilizer Soap making, drain cleaning Batteries, biodiesel production

Uses and Applications:
  • Animal Feed Preservative: Calcium formate is used in animal feed within the EU to prevent microbial growth and extend shelf life. It lowers feed pH, making it less conducive to bacteria and fungi.
  • Leather Tanning: Acts as a masking agent in chrome tanning, promoting faster and more efficient leather penetration.
  • Construction: Used as a grout and cement additive to improve hardness, reduce setting time, and prevent efflorescence.
  • Deicing: Effective when combined with urea, it causes less corrosion compared to other deicers.
  • Environmental: Used in wet flue gas desulfurization (WFGS) to remove sulfur oxides from exhaust gases, aiding in pollution control.
Production and Sources:
  • Production Methods: Calcium formate is produced as a co-product during trimethylolpropane production or can be synthesized from calcium hydroxide and carbon monoxide or calcium chloride and formic acid.
  • Origin: Mainly produced in China.
